m food delivery to renting a car or handling money. However, a group of hardworking developers behind any app always turns an idea into a working and usable application. This article explores transitioning from an idea to the app store with the help of a leading.
The Structure of Mobile App Development Company in New York
New York is not only the city that never tanzohub sleeps; it is also the technological center of the country. This city is leading in mobile app development, with an active startup scene and numerous tech players. Businesses here are associated with creativity, advanced solutions, and the usage of new technologies. New York is perfect for individuals who want to create a new mobile application.
Why Choose a Mobile App Development Company in New York?
Expertise and experience are exceptionally crucial when it comes to developing mobile applications. One New York-based mobile app development company provides both, thanks to the city’s immense talent pool and constantly progressing technological landscape. It is always good to work with such companies since they are updated with the current technology to develop your app correctly. Moreover, most of these companies are located near the major markets, which allows them to have a deeper insight into consumer behavior and market needs.
Success for Mobile Application Development Companies:
It is important to note that developing a mobile app is not a one-step process but a detailed procedure.
- Ideation and Conceptualization: This is where the app’s concept is conceived. It is crucial to determine what the app is for, who it is suitable for, and its most essential characteristics.
- Market Research and Analysis: Market knowledge is essential. This includes assessing rivals, opportunities, and users.
- Design and Prototyping: A good app interface is intuitive and aesthetically pleasing. Prototyping aids in representing the layout and app’s workings.
- Development and Testing: This is the core phase where the app is built. Rigorous testing ensures the app is bug-free and performs well.
- Deployment and Launch: Once the app is ready, it’s deployed to the app store. This involves meeting all the guidelines and requirements set by the app store.
Essential Factors to Look at When Hiring a Mobile App Development Company
In this case, it is crucial to be very selective when selecting an application development company.
- Strong Portfolio: A good company should be able to display its portfolio to show its previous work done.
- Transparent Processes: Accountability for carrying out project processes and progress reports.
- Client Testimonials: Good recommendations and recommendations of a prior customer.
- Dedicated Support: Continued support even after the application was launched.
Case Study: Food Delivery App Development
Popular food delivery apps have made ordering much more accessible than traditional methods. Some essential parameters critical for a food delivery app development company to consider are an intuitive interface, options to track delivery in real-time, and safe payment solutions. Exploring a successful food delivery app may be valuable in identifying what has been done right and what typical issues are present.
For instance, let us assume you are working on a food delivery application in one of the busiest cities – New York. The app should be able to process many orders, give precise timing information about deliveries, and be user-friendly. Thus, such an app must be compatible with different restaurants, offer tracking to users, and provide safe payment. It is clear, therefore, from the positive results of the case study discussed above that these features are significant and the strategies used to realize them.
Case Study: Development of an Application for An On-Demand Service
Mobile platforms and applications deliver different services depending on the customer’s needs, including transportation and home services. Possible key success factors that define successful apps in this category may include effective booking procedures, dependable services, and the provision of quality customer services. Studying a successful business model in the context of apps can help reveal their essential functions and effective practices.
Let’s take the concept of an on-demand service gimkitjoin app that helps users find local service providers like plumbers, electricians, or cleaners. For the app’s success, it is crucial to select trustworthy professionals, disclose prices, and guarantee fast service. A more comprehensive example could show how the app addresses these elements at the various stages of operation, from sign-up through the consumption of the services offered to guarantee satisfactory results.
Technologies and Tools Used in Mobile App Development Company
Developers use various technologies and tools to build robust mobile apps. These include:
- Programming Languages: Swift for iOS, Kotlin for Android, and JavaScript for cross-platform apps.
- Frameworks and Libraries: React Native, Flutter, and Xamarin.
- Tools for Testing and Deployment: Jenkins, Firebase, and TestFlight.
Using the right combination of these technologies ensures that the app is scalable, efficient, and user-friendly. For instance, React Native allows developers to create cross-platform apps with a single codebase, reducing development time and costs while maintaining high performance.
Challenges in Mobile App Development and How to Overcome Them
Mobile app development comes with its set of challenges:
- Technical Challenges: Ensuring compatibility across devices and operating systems.
- Market Challenges: Standing out in a crowded market.
- Regulatory Challenges: Complying with app store guidelines and data privacy regulations.
Overcoming these challenges requires technical expertise, market understanding, and regulatory knowledge. For example, ensuring device compatibility involves rigorous testing on different platforms and screen sizes. Standing out in a crowded market requires a unique value proposition and effective marketing strategies. Compliance with regulatory guidelines involves staying updated with the latest regulations and incorporating necessary data privacy and security features.
The Role of User Experience (UX) in App Development
User experience is critical to an app’s success. A well-designed UX ensures users find the app easy to use and engaging. Best practices for UX design include intuitive navigation, responsive design, and user feedback mechanisms.
For example, a food delivery app with an intuitive interface allows users to browse menus, place orders, and track deliveries effortlessly. Responsive design ensures the app works seamlessly on various devices, from smartphones to tablets. Using user feedback mechanisms like ratings and reviews helps improve the app based on user input.
Exploring the Mobile App Development Environment
Let me state at this point that the mobile app industry is dynamic. Some of the emerging trends include relying on AI and machine learning, the application of augmented and virtual reality, and an increase in IoT applications within apps. Awareness of these trends can help you position your app to stand out.
Here, AI and machine learning can help improve the user experience and increase the application’s performance. AR and VR can make an app more engaging since they provide an experiential element to the device. Some IoT app owners can interact with smart devices, making IoT app integration easy and convenient.
Criteria for Selecting the Right Mobile App Development Company in New York or Anywhere in the World
Choose the mobile app development company in New York by checking its experience, trying to get an idea of its development process, and finally, considering the communication level and support. Ensure you find a company that shares your vision and can meet its goals and objectives.
Some focus areas are the company’s experience, the skills and experience of its employees, and how it handles projects. While the development is happening, frequent updates and clear communication show that a partner is credible. Also, maintaining the app after its release plays a significant role since it helps solve problems that may hinder its success.
The Post-Launch Support and the Maintenance: What is Necessary to Know
Developing an app is not the end of the story but rather the beginning of app success. Constant support is vital for fixing, updating, and addressing user concerns and other issues regarding the app. Skilled app developers should give post-launch support to their applications.
Maintenance is required because the apps need regular updates to address new glitches, incorporate new functionality, and enhance performance. Over time, user feedback analysis reveals concerns that must be addressed to improve customer experience. Support may also include integrating the application with other platforms, handling the app’s growth as the number of users increases, and keeping the application relevant and current amid emerging market trends.
Closing
Creating a mobile app is a multi-step process that demands a professional approach, creativity, and passion. If you choose a reputable mobile app development company in New York, you will be assured of a well-developed application relevant to the targeted users. The right partner means your app can succeed and create a sustainable social impact.
0 Comments